Produktion af Hydrogen med grøn energi i Ø-drift
Project purpose is to develop, test, demonstrate and mature a solution, that by supply of green energy from wind turbines, solar panels, and a battery system, with and without grid connection, can produce hydrogen by electrolysis in a stable and cost effective manner.
This project aims to develop, test, and demonstrate solutions related to the production of green hydrogen in different grid scenarios, with the main focus on off-grid / island operation. With some of the most favourable wind and solar conditions commonly being in remote areas onshore and offshore, reliable operation in reduced or off-grid conditions is paramount for cost-effective scaling and accelerating green hydrogen production in these locations.
This project includes wind turbines and solar PV with an electrolyser solution including a battery energy storage system, which will be integrated to operate off-grid in a stable and cost effectively manner. The project represents a critical step towards maturation of solutions and enablement of large-scale hydrogen production off-grid.
It's a project cooperation between Eurowind Energy A/S and Vestas Wind Systems A/S aimed at showcasing and deepening the understanding of the requirements that arise and need to be addressed in future solutions by all parties involved.

Participants
Partner | Subsidy | Auto financing |
---|---|---|
VESTAS WIND SYSTEMS A/S | 25,37 mio. DKK | 38,06 mio. DKK |
Eurowind Energy A/S | 22,20 mio. DKK | 33,30 mio. DKK |
